When it comes to the perfect place? There isn't any. Just, pick a peaceful location to meditate where you feel warm and unwinded and diversions are minimal. Especially for novices, starting with little, manageable pieces of time for example, 3, 5, or 10 minutes is crucial so you can develop your practice and discover your sweet area (which varies for everybody).

That's the only method you'll keep showing up day after day. Research study shows that combining a 30-second action with a "practice anchor" can make new regimens more likely to stick. The 30-second action can be anything that might prompt you to start your brand-new daily meditation routine (For instance: "I will count 15 inhales and exhale breath cycles for 30 seconds before I start practicing meditation").


Pick a meditation posture that feels helpful for your body. This could be being in a chair or on a couch with feet flat on the floor, kneeling, legs crossed on a company cushion or yoga mat, resting on your back, or even standing or walking. If you're sitting, try to keep your back straight, your hands resting on your lap or knees, your eyes gazing softly into the middle distance or at a spot on the floor in front of you.

Feel totally free to choose whatever position feels best for you (and, know that this position could alter depending on the day). Comfy clothing are ideal, and you can even drape a blanket over yourself if you tend to feel cold while sitting still if that feels more enjoyable (Meditation). A guide or a guided meditation app like the Headspace app can be a useful, available tool for developing an everyday meditation practice.

The benefits of meditation in the early morning have less to do with meditation itself and more to do with setting the phase for the day ahead. Meditation is typically viewed as a safe method to enhance your general wellness, and it may provide a number of physical and psychological health benefits. If you desire to add meditation to your routine, there's no "bad" time of day to do it, however the benefits of meditating in the morning might be appealing.

"Traditional wisdom is that the morning is a fun time to do it, and if you can make time in the early morning, that is fantastic. However if not whenever you can set aside for meditation is the correct time."Meditation's are not based on the time of day, however there are reasons that specialists frequently suggest meditation in the morning.

Mathews points out there's a meditation stating, frequently attributed to Gandhi, that on the days he is truly busy, he practices meditation for 2 hours in the early morning rather of 1.

, a certified scientific social worker from St. Louis, Missouri, early mornings tend to have an inherent sense of peace before the hustle and bustle of the day."Early mornings provide a chance to have time alone, while everyone else continues to sleep," she says.

One of the fantastic things about meditation is that you don't have to set a substantial duration of time aside for it, especially when you're simply beginning out. Schmidt includes that early mornings are likewise an ideal time to check out meditation in an environment where you're currently unwinded and comfortable your bed.

Sometimes a use this link couple of minutes of mediation may be all you need to achieve the right level of focus and clearness to meet a challenge head-on."There really isn't an excellent or bad quantity of time to practice meditation," Mathews states.
